Hi all, I am having a hard time with a few differences in Big Sur.

Collections. Is there an easier Voiceover way to navigate these? I’m finding 
them everywhere: news, App Store, messages. Is VO-j the best way? It seems like 
I need to interact several times to get into the content. Any advice on this?

Notifications. Notifications seem to take Voiceover’s focus. I was on Safari, 
and Messages, when notifications came through. I could not get Voiceover’s 
focus to automatically return to the apps I was originally in. I had to 
VO-shift-d to focus on desktop, then return to my other apps. Is there 
something I’m missing here?

Lastly, VO-f search. Are you guys experiencing odd behavior when you perform a 
Voiceover search? I can be in a webpage and search for a word. The first result 
works fine, but then Voiceover’s focus changes with subsequent results. Like it 
gets stuck in the sentences where the searched word is. I used to be able to 
navigate a webpage via searching for a particular word. How is this working for 
you guys?

Thanks, I’m just not finding Big Sur seamless so far.
